When Jem and Scout go into town, people whisper about them and make remarks behindtheir backs, such as, Theres his chillun or Yonders some Finches. Jem and Scout overhear one man say, They cn go loose and rape up the countryside for all of em who run this county care, a reference to Atticuss defense of Tom Robinson. Toward the end of chapter 21, Judge Taylor reads the guilty verdict, and Scout recalls Jems painful reaction by saying, His [Jems] hands were white from gripping the balcony rail, and his shoulders jerked as if each guilty was a separate stab between them (Lee, 215).
